Jump to content
Fivewin Brasil

Erro na indexacao


siscat

Recommended Posts

Existe a possibilidade de usar o ADS Local com Clipper 5.2 + Fivewin ?

Estou tendo problemas na indexacao de arquivos com mais de 80000 registros. O sistema simplesmente trava. Este erro ocorre quando eu compilo tanto com o fivewin quanto sem o fivewin. Sera algum problema ou limitacao do RDD do clipper (DBFCDX)?

Com o DBFNTX nao da problema!

Link to comment
Share on other sites

  • 2 weeks later...

São tantas duvidas que eu tinha me esquecido que tinha postado esta pergunta!

Caro colega, eu tenho todos os codigos de acesso a base de dados funcionando a bastante tempo, na verdade desde o Summer, e posso te garantir que não existe a menor possibilidade de ter algo errado nele.

Quando compilo minha aplicação somente com o clipper 5.2e (que eu utilizo a bastante tempo) minha rotina de indexação funciona perfeitamente... independente da quantidade de registros das tabelas. Já com clipper 5.3 a mesma rotina gera varios erros de run-time enquanto tenta gerar os indices. E com o clipper 5.2e + Fivewin tambem acontece a mesma coisa... PAU...PAU..PAU...

ah.. somente quando utilizo o DBFCDX que eu não largo por nada... hehehe

Link to comment
Share on other sites

A versão 5.3b do clipper foi que deixou estável o RDD DBFCDX, utilize desta versão que vc não terá problemas icon_smile.gif eu utilizo a muito tempo

citação:

São tantas duvidas que eu tinha me esquecido que tinha postado esta pergunta!

Caro colega, eu tenho todos os codigos de acesso a base de dados funcionando a bastante tempo, na verdade desde o Summer, e posso te garantir que não existe a menor possibilidade de ter algo errado nele.

Quando compilo minha aplicação somente com o clipper 5.2e (que eu utilizo a bastante tempo) minha rotina de indexação funciona perfeitamente... independente da quantidade de registros das tabelas. Já com clipper 5.3 a mesma rotina gera varios erros de run-time enquanto tenta gerar os indices. E com o clipper 5.2e + Fivewin tambem acontece a mesma coisa... PAU...PAU..PAU...

ah.. somente quando utilizo o DBFCDX que eu não largo por nada... hehehe


id=quote>id=quote>
Link to comment
Share on other sites

Vou testar novamente com o Clipper 5.3b.

Eu só não entendo uma coisa!

Porque tudo funciona perfeitamente com o 5.2e.

E quando eu utilizo com o FW o sistema é abortado no meio da indexação????

o codigo utilizado é o que segue:

INDEX ON FIELD->&cKeyInd TAG &cTag TO &cFile EVAL(Indexing(oMtrInd, RecNo()))

Function Indexing( oMtr, nRec )

// quantidade de reistros

oMtr:Set( nRec )

SysRefresh()

Return(.T.)

Link to comment
Share on other sites

Tente aumentar o StackSize e HeapSize eu normalmente utilizo:

StackSize 17000

HeapSize 4096

citação:

Vou testar novamente com o Clipper 5.3b.

Eu só não entendo uma coisa!

Porque tudo funciona perfeitamente com o 5.2e.

E quando eu utilizo com o FW o sistema é abortado no meio da indexação????

o codigo utilizado é o que segue:

INDEX ON FIELD->&cKeyInd TAG &cTag TO &cFile EVAL(Indexing(oMtrInd, RecNo()))

Function Indexing( oMtr, nRec )

// quantidade de reistros

oMtr:Set( nRec )

SysRefresh()

Return(.T.)


id=quote>id=quote>
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Loading...
×
×
  • Create New...